...London Bridge is a simple box girder bridge made of concrete and steel that crosses the River Thames in central London. Today, it often gets confused with the nearby Tower Bridge, which is a much larger and more recognizable structure. No one is totally sure why there's a nursery rhyme about the London Bridge collapsing, but some think it references a destructive Viking raid in the year 1014.
